Transaction 23a4eaa6db8f73c78312cab71ecc98fc8230f8c868a550969d5a183cd62f67be

1 Input
2 Outputs
  • 23a4eaa6db8f73c78312cab71ecc98fc8230f8c868a550969d5a183cd62f67be:0
  • value  10667214
    address  12BvbKR2Sn8XGpwiCxiFD8F8QpZVeDTKiq
  • 23a4eaa6db8f73c78312cab71ecc98fc8230f8c868a550969d5a183cd62f67be:1
  • value  949536352
    address  13TiMqXUj65eviJPs4to6LzCTbExwjYWNH